Soccer Recap: Easley vs. Greenwood
After losing to Greenwood the last time they met, Easley decided to demonstrate that turnabout is fair play. While the 2-2 score might suggest a draw, it was the Easley Green Wave who were credited with the victory. The Easley Green Wave got it done in the shootout by posting four goals to the Greenwood Eagles' three. Easley's winning goal came courtesy of Ellyss Easterling.
Easley has been performing well recently as they've won six of their last eight contests, which provided a massive bump to their 8-7-1 record this season. As for Greenwood, they have traveled a rocky road recently having lost three of their last four matches, which put a noticeable dent in their 9-3 record this season.
Both squads are looking forward to the support of their home crowds in their upcoming games. Easley's homestand will continue as they prepare to take on Berea at 7:00 p.m. on Friday. Easley is facing Berea at the right time seeing as Berea is stuck on a ten-game losing streak. As for Greenwood, they will look to defend their home pitch on Friday against Westside at 5:30 p.m. Greenwood's defense has only allowed 0.5 goals per game this season, so Westside's offense will have their work cut out for them.
